Output 7540da3c94a8cf00f8a170db45c29be1c6822ca993e00a166e80fcb840036520:0

value
27004446
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dbf31c8775f41f538dd4a6c19839df9fb9af671689fe91d50b41ae357e76935d
address
bc1pm0e3epm47s048rw55mqeswwln7u67eck38lfr4gtgxhr2lnkjdws4ve9rw
transaction
7540da3c94a8cf00f8a170db45c29be1c6822ca993e00a166e80fcb840036520
confirmations
22418
spent
true